Re: [StrongED] Re: Swapping versions

In message <5707072cf0Lists@xxxxxxxxxxx>
          "Richard Torrens (lists)" <Lists@xxxxxxxxxxx> wrote:

> In article <9a13000757.fjgraute@xxxxxxxxx>,
>    Fred Graute <fjgraute@xxxxxxxxx> wrote:
> > There is simpler way of doing this. If you have StrED_cfg next to
> > StrongED then you can simple install another version of SE along with
> > its own StrED_cfg. You can run either version or even both versions at
> > the same time.
> > If StrED_cfg is in Boot:Choices then it's a bit more complicated. The
> > easiest solution is to move StrED_cfg into the same directory as SE
> > (the one that you run normally). Then as per above paragraph.
> > If you want to keep StrED_cfg in Boot:Choices then you need to be very
> > careful. For each extra version of SE you'll need to put StrED_cfg next
> > to it. You start your main version normally but any other version needs
> > to be run by Ctrl-doubleclick to force the use of the local StrED_cfg.
> Interesting...
> Once the script has been worked out the swap is very simple so I will
> stick with that, but the other method will get into the instructions.

Fair enough.

> The simple method could get confusing as unless you quit one version
> before running the second you would always have two versions running.
> Having several files open, it would need close attention to the file
> path in the header bar.
> Which version would load a clicked file?

That depends on which is in the lower application slot. Apparently RISC
OS uses slots to keep track of running tasks. Message broadcasts are
sent to the lowest slot first then moving up. When a task quits its slot
becomes free ready for a new task.

As an experiment try this (with an 'empty' iconbar):

 - Start Draw, Help, Paint, SciCalc, StrongED
 - Doubleclick a text file, should open in SE
 - Now quit Draw and run Edit
 - Doubleclick a text file, where does it load?

> But I am working from StrongHelp instructions... Are the latest changes in
> StrongHelp?

The 4.70a12 changes? No, I don't think all of them have been added yet.


